  1. Baroness Louise Lehzen was Princess Victoria's governess from 1824 and became the young queen's unofficial aide after she ascended the throne in 1837. In her journal the young princess described her governess as "the most affectionate, devoted, attached, and disinterested friend I have, and I love her most dearly."

Queen Victoria recorded her former governesss gift of her portrait in her Journal on 30 January 1843: I received from Lehzen her miniature, done at Berlin, which is a very good likeness (RA QVJ). An identical version, presumably given by the Baroness to Feodora, Princess of Hohenlohe-Langenburg, is at Schloss Langenburg.   5. 3 de dic. de 2019 · Louise Lehzen was born in Hanover in 1784. As the daughter of a Lutheran Pastor, she was born into modest social circumstances, but through favourable connections, she moved to England in 1819 to become governess to Princess Feodore, Queen Victoria’s older half-sister.
